Sony’s acquisition of Crunchyroll marks a significant strategic move in the anime streaming industry. By integrating Crunchyroll into its portfolio, Sony aims to consolidate its position as a global leader in anime content distribution.
Key Details of the Acquisition
- Acquisition Value: Sony purchased Crunchyroll for approximately $1.175 billion.
- Purpose: To enhance Sony’s existing anime streaming services and expand its global reach.
- Integration: Crunchyroll will be combined with Sony’s Funimation to create a unified platform for anime fans.
Impact on Anime Streaming
This acquisition is expected to reshape the anime streaming landscape in several ways:
- Content Library Expansion: Joining Crunchyroll’s extensive catalog with Sony’s assets will provide users with a richer variety of titles.
- Global Accessibility: Strengthening distribution channels worldwide will make anime more accessible to international audiences.
- Competitive Edge: The consolidated service will challenge rivals by offering improved user experience and exclusive content.
Strategic Importance for Sony
For Sony, this move aligns with its broader strategy to capitalize on the growing popularity of anime and digital streaming:
- Enhances Sony’s foothold in the digital entertainment market.
- Leverages cross-promotional opportunities with Sony’s other media assets.
- Positions Sony for sustained growth in a rapidly evolving industry.
